Transaction b3d368bc62a61e10e9aab84a5c9ec2c84e185b0566e4796aa4ffb90640d14125
1 Input
1 Output
-
b3d368bc62a61e10e9aab84a5c9ec2c84e185b0566e4796aa4ffb90640d14125:0
- value
- 639616
- script pubkey
- OP_0 OP_PUSHBYTES_32 ddc4a5081ab5a17996f649871b42e97de49b315366b3b9a7c883da055210136d
- address
- bc1qmhz22zq6kkshn9hkfxr3kshf0hjfkv2nv6emnf7gs0dq25sszdksy6jp09